>>There are only a handful of companies who can afford to spend $5M to
>>produce and air a SB spot. I saw no car commercials other than the rather
>>bland Escalade commerical from GM (twice) and only Anhieser/Busch beer
>>and Pepsi soft drink spots. Seems to me the NFL's exclusive advertising
>>deals are doing more harm than good to the carrying network. I'm sure
>>Toyota, Ford and Chrysler/MB would have loved to get into the game. But
>>without the huge payout required for the rest of the deal, they said no.
